Career

John worked at the University of Loughborough and Brunel University before moving to Bath. He has also held visiting positions at Dartmouth College, New Hampshire and the University of Illinois in the US, the Universite-Pantheon-Assas Paris II in France and the University of Trier in Germany.

Education

John holds a PhD from the London School of Economics and Political Science.
